Output d76cc357f25a38c6f0bf3cfa0d8ff72ec012e419c0ce26cde8429003e5318cbc:0

value
323735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07ae54b70cd137347ab4909589de040f3448cee OP_EQUAL
address
3PcZKXPZSkUdmQ41vvE2nknaLELDWiVohy
transaction
d76cc357f25a38c6f0bf3cfa0d8ff72ec012e419c0ce26cde8429003e5318cbc
confirmations
201654
spent
true